UnavailableInvalidChannel: HTTP 404 NOT FOUND for channel python3.1 #12785

Closed geofrunz closed 1 year ago

geofrunz commented 1 year ago


What happened?

Dear All, I'm trying to install some libraries using Conda, but every time I try I get the following message (regardless of the package I'm trying to install (Spades, GATK, predicthaplom etc):

Collecting package metadata (current_repodata.json): failed

UnavailableInvalidChannel: HTTP 404 NOT FOUND for channel python3.1

The channel is not accessible or is invalid.

You will need to adjust your conda configuration to proceed. Use conda config --show channels to view your configuration's current state, and use conda config --show-sources to view config file locations.

It happened quite suddenly. everything was working fine and then this problem start to appear. Does anybody have any idea how to solve it?

Conda Info

active environment : /home/giovanni/anaconda3/envs/haphpipe
    active env location : /home/giovanni/anaconda3/envs/haphpipe
            shell level : 2
       user config file : /home/giovanni/.condarc
 populated config files : /home/giovanni/.condarc
          conda version : 23.3.1
    conda-build version : not installed
         python version :
       virtual packages : __archspec=1=x86_64
       base environment : /home/giovanni/miniconda3  (writable)
      conda av data dir : /home/giovanni/miniconda3/etc/conda
  conda av metadata url : None
           channel URLs :
          package cache : /home/giovanni/miniconda3/pkgs
       envs directories : /home/giovanni/miniconda3/envs
               platform : linux-64
             user-agent : conda/23.3.1 requests/2.28.1 CPython/3.10.10 Linux/4.15.0-202-generic ubuntu/18.04.1 glibc/2.27
                UID:GID : 1000:1000
             netrc file : None
           offline mode : False

Conda Config

==> /home/giovanni/.condarc <==
channel_priority: disabled
  - conda-forge
  - bioconda
  - defaults
  - R
  - python3.6/linux-64
  - python3.1
  - python
  - python3.6

Additional Context

No response

travishathaway commented 1 year ago

Hi @geofrunz,

Thanks for filing this issue. Is there a reason you have the following channels defined in your .condarc file?

  - python3.6/linux-64
  - python3.1
  - python
  - python3.6

Those channels are not normally necessary. I doubt that the python3.1 even exists, which is most likely why you are seeing that error.

To remedy this, simply remove those lines.

geofrunz commented 1 year ago

Thank you so much, It solved the problem. Actually, I don't know when they were added... surely I didn't do it actively, maybe during the installation of some packages. Thank you again Giovanni

Il giorno ven 9 giu 2023 alle ore 12:39 Travis Hathaway < @.***> ha scritto:

Hi @geofrunz,

Thanks for filing this issue. Is there a reason you have the following channels defined in your .condarc file?

  • python3.6/linux-64
  • python3.1
  • python
  • python3.6

Those channels are not normally necessary. I doubt that the python3.1 even exists, which is most likely why you are seeing that error.

To remedy this, simply remove those lines.

— Reply to this email directly, view it on GitHub, or unsubscribe . You are receiving this because you were mentioned.Message ID: @.***>